3 Brilliant but Overlooked Driverless Vehicle Stocks to Buy and Hold for 10 Years
Yahoo Financeยท 2025-10-11 17:54
Core Insights - Mobileye is currently unprofitable, with an expected operating loss between $436 million to $512 million for the full year, but it has approximately $1.7 billion in cash and cash equivalents, rising free cash flow, and minimal debt, positioning it to navigate industry challenges [1] - The company is enhancing its growth through strategic partnerships with automakers like ZEEKR, Porsche, Mahindra, and Volkswagen, focusing on Advanced Driver Assistance Systems (ADAS) [2][3] - Mobileye's technology is aimed at improving automotive safety and productivity, with a growing adoption of multicamera setups to support hands-free driving [3][4] Company Overview - Mobileye Global (NASDAQ: MBLY) specializes in developing and deploying ADAS and autonomous driving technologies, offering comprehensive software and hardware solutions for automakers [4] - The company is viewed as a solid investment opportunity in the robotaxi sector, particularly for investors looking to avoid the volatility associated with Tesla [4][6] Market Potential - The robotaxi ride-share market is projected to grow at a 90% compound annual growth rate from 2025 to 2030, indicating significant investment opportunities in this sector [5] - The driverless vehicle market is expected to be worth trillions of dollars within a decade, highlighting the immense growth potential for companies like Mobileye [6][16] Competitive Landscape - The number of robotaxis and driverless vehicles is anticipated to increase significantly, from approximately 1,500 currently to about 35,000 by 2030, suggesting a robust market for ADAS technologies [16][17] - Mobileye, along with Aptiv and Hesai, is positioned as a key player in advancing driverless vehicles and ADAS, making them attractive options for investors [17]
